Meghan Markle will ‘no doubt’ overtake Princess Catherine in popularity

Meghan Markle and Princess Catherine have long been compared in terms of their public appeal, but royal experts now suggest that the Duchess of Sussex may soon overtake the Princess of Wales in popularity. With Meghan’s growing influence in Hollywood, her global brand expansion, and the shifting public perception of the monarchy, some believe she is poised to eclipse Catherine on the world stage.

Since stepping back from royal duties in 2020, Meghan has carefully crafted her own path outside of the traditional constraints of the monarchy. She and Prince Harry’s Netflix deals, lucrative partnerships, and public advocacy have positioned her as a major figure in media and philanthropy. Her recent high-profile appearances, including speaking engagements and charity work, have only strengthened her standing as an independent global influencer.

Meanwhile, Princess Catherine remains a beloved figure within the royal family, admired for her grace, poise, and dedication to charitable causes. However, her position is inherently tied to the monarchy, meaning she operates within strict royal protocols. While Catherine enjoys widespread admiration, particularly in the UK, Meghan’s ability to engage with a broader, international audience could give her an edge in terms of global reach.

A key factor in Meghan’s rising popularity is her ability to control her narrative. By stepping away from royal life, she has been able to speak openly about issues close to her heart, including mental health, feminism, and racial equality. Her candid interviews, including the explosive 2021 Oprah Winfrey sit-down, allowed her to connect with audiences who felt she represented modern, progressive values.

Additionally, Meghan and Harry’s philanthropic initiatives through the Archewell Foundation continue to boost her public image. From supporting women’s rights to mental health advocacy, her work resonates with younger generations who value activism and authenticity.

On the other hand, Princess Catherine remains a pillar of tradition, seen as the future Queen Consort. While she enjoys immense popularity, particularly in the UK, her public persona is largely shaped by the royal family’s established image. Unlike Meghan, she rarely engages in personal storytelling or controversial topics, which can make her appear more reserved in comparison.

Royal experts argue that Meghan’s relatability, combined with her Hollywood background, makes her more accessible to a global audience. Her connections in the entertainment industry, including friendships with A-list celebrities, further elevate her visibility beyond the confines of the royal family.

However, Catherine’s long-standing reputation as a devoted mother, dedicated royal, and graceful leader ensures she will always hold a special place in the public’s heart. The question remains whether Meghan’s evolving brand and growing influence will eventually surpass Catherine’s deep-rooted royal appeal.

While Catherine may remain the most beloved royal in the UK, Meghan’s trajectory as a global icon suggests she could “no doubt” overtake her in worldwide popularity, especially among younger and more progressive audiences. As both women continue to carve their legacies, the competition for public favor will undoubtedly be one to watch.
